Josie Barnes, local runner and run club founder from Eastbourne has been named as and ASICS Front Runner
She is set to do her first race this weekend (12th April), the Paris Marathon. It is her first race abroad she is super excited to experience running in a different country.
Josie says " I'm so grateful to be given this opportunity to run for a brand who acknowledges the importance of running for a sound mins in a sound body". Josie has been battling the winter viruses which has impeded her training however consistency and showing up each week will be what matters on the day. The Front runner wants to "prove to myself and others that you don't have to be 'elite' at something to achieve great things!"
Josie runs the Instagram account @runwithjosie_ to document her previous marathon training however ever since her following has grown. She now hosts a run club every Saturday morning in Eastbourne from Twin Coffee at the Saffrons in Eastbourne. She welcomes all running abilities and once a month she partners with Run Your Mind to help start conversations around mental health. You can follow Josie's journey over on Instagram
